Web4 hours ago · Further, honey bees nest above ground, live in colonies with intricate social interactions, and store food in the form of, yes, honey. Cellophane bees live below ground and, while their holes might look as though they all belong to a larger underground colony, their behavior is solitary. WebOct 13, 2014 · A solitary pulmonary nodule (SPN) is defined as a round opacity that is smaller than 3 cm. It may be solid or subsolid in attenuation. Semisolid nodules may have purely ground-glass attenuation or be partly solid (mixed solid and ground-glass attenuation). The widespread use of multidetector computed tomography (CT) has …

It is believed they feed exclusively on the pollen from a plant called Ashe’s … WebApr 25, 2024 · Consider the wasp's size. Some scoliid wasps — commonly seen on lawns in parts of the United States — have bodies 3/4 of an inch long. Compare that with the cicada killer, one of the most impressive of the ground-nesting wasps. This solitary hunter may grow be two inches long.

WebSweat Bees are also known as halictid bees. Sweat bees are attracted to perspiration. They are a diverse group of metallic and non-metallic bees that can vary significantly in appearance. Sweat bees may be solitary or eusocial, with most halictids nesting underground.
